ZIP 14204 Foreclosure, Tax-Lien & Distress Report

Erie County, New York · High Vacancy market

ZIP 14204's composite property-distress score is 23/100 - DLRadar classes that as low for Erie County, New York. It additionally carries heavy environmental risk: climate & FEMA risk (98/100), flood (NFIP) exposure (80/100). Structural exposure scores 51 and live distress 2 on the 0–100 scale. Property-level stress concentrates in structural risk (51/100), construction/permit lag (26/100), institutional ownership (18/100). On the quiet end sit institutional ownership (18/100) and mortgage stress (7/100).

The peak-phase market in 14204 posted values that rose 4.1% over the year (phase confidence 34/100). At a peak the opportunity is selective — specific stressed parcels, not a broad discount.

Median household income is $26,000, below the U.S. median near $78,000. Roughly 34.8% live below the poverty line, elevated and often tied to deferred-maintenance inventory. Vacancy runs 21.6%, above the national norm and a classic distress-and-opportunity signal. Rent burden reaches 49% of tenant households. The demographic-stress sub-score lands at 49/100. About 16% have a four-year degree. A median home runs $152,400 here, or 5.8 times local income. Population is roughly 7,748 with a median age of 41. 30% of housing is owner-occupied. The ZIP holds roughly 5,470 housing units.
